The counselling course of action really should be sure that the shopper is aware of all contraceptive options. In which applicable, the counselling ought to require the two partners. The consumer's conclusion for vasectomy has to be created voluntarily and once the thing to consider of each of the challenges, Advantages and alternatives. Fantastic counselling for men serious about vasectomy is important for 2 good reasons: vasectomy is lasting, and vasectomy is a surgical process that carries with it the threats inherent in any medical procedures. Simply because men's biggest fears about vasectomy are connected to suffering with the treatment, impact on sexual working, and likely for adverse outcomes,32 these matters need to be completely coated for the duration of counselling. Clientele also needs to be knowledgeable with the tiny danger of pregnancy following vasectomy even in consumers who've postvasectomy azoospermia various a long time once the method.one, 27, 33 Throughout counselling, the next critical details should be lined.34, 35, 36

During the duration of improvements in vasectomy system, the surgery was starting to acquire traction to be a voluntary contraceptive technique in elements of Asia. Starting in 1952, the government of India designed systems to inspire young Guys to obtain vasectomies as a method of population Manage. They appealed to Guys as a result of different means for example vasectomy camps and festivals the place doctors could accomplish enormous volumes of vasectomies To put it briefly amounts of time.

The population considerations in Asian international locations throughout the 1960s and nineteen seventies spurred Yet another innovation in vasectomy strategy, the no-scalpel vasectomy. All through that time, Li Shunqiang, a surgeon who was Functioning on the Chongqing Relatives Planning Scientific Investigate Institute during the Sichuan province source of China, formulated a whole new strategy for accessing the vas deferens to accomplish a vasectomy. Termed no-scalpel vasectomy, or NSV, Li’s technique relies on using specialized surgical devices to grasp the vas deferens from the skin of the scrotum and puncture the pores and skin to obtain the tube.
